Paul Fritsche Foundation Scientific Forum e.V.

Motto: “Scientific progress in responsibility”

The Paul Fritsche Foundation Scientific Forum was founded in 1987 and is based in Homburg. It exclusively and directly pursues charitable purposes. It is a non-proftit foundation and does not pursue its own economic purposes.

The foundation serves scientific progress in a responsible manner. This purpose is achieved in particular by using the foundation's funds 

  • for interdisciplinary scientific events,
  • to supplement courses within Saarland University,
  • informing and educating the public about scientific progress and the problems associated with it,
  • to prepare statements for public institutions.

 

Bodies of the Foundation

The Foundation's bodies are the Foundation’s Executive Board, consisting of seven members, and the General Assembly.

Memberships

Membership as a founder

Founders are natural or legal persons who donate an amount of at least €500 when they join the foundation and commit to an annual contribution of €100 or more.

Membership as a sponsor

Sponsors are natural or legal persons with a minimum annual contribution of €125.

Ordinary membership

Ordinary members are those who pay a minimum annual membership fee of €25.
